- The distance between Iqaluit, Nt, Canada and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i, Usa is approximately 2,485 km or 1,544 mi.
- To reach Iqaluit, Nt in this distance one would set out from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i bearing 16.9°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Iqaluit, Nt bearing 28.7° or NNE .
- Iqaluit, Nt has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Iqaluit, Nt is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 18.3 °C (32.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.8 °C (14°F) more in Iqaluit, Nt.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 372.5 mm (14.7 in) less which is equivalent to 372.5 l/m² (9.14 US gal/ft²) or 3,725,000 l/ha (398,227 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.7° lower in Iqaluit, Nt than in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i.
